Output 83e21d37a1778c04f81aa3c0c9c5fc948eaaf84230d4b9cb41f5b4eea098a50c:0

value
714101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e61640f3360a2f61264e5b2c13693703bee9929 OP_EQUAL
address
3EfrYcrifP6rfPPZ3e39Y65bi1xyMoxr4A
transaction
83e21d37a1778c04f81aa3c0c9c5fc948eaaf84230d4b9cb41f5b4eea098a50c
confirmations
238260
spent
true